What Nudges and Holds Actually Do to Your Game

Strip away the modern gloss and a fruit machine is just a set of reels stopping on symbols. The nudge and hold features are the original player controls, long before bonus rounds and free spins became standard. A hold lets you lock one or more reels in place while the others spin again, giving you a second chance to line up a winning combination. A nudge moves a single reel up or down by one position — sometimes two — to push a near-miss into a genuine win.

In the online versions you will find in 2026, these mechanics appear in two forms. The traditional form works exactly as described: you win a nudge or a hold as a reward, often after landing two matching symbols with a third just out of reach. The modern form arrives as a bonus feature inside a bigger game, where nudges and holds become tools you use during a free-spins round to chase multipliers. Both approaches are worth your time, but they feel very different in the hand.

Reading RTP and Volatility Without the Marketing Fluff

Every slot publishes a Return to Player percentage, and every slot machine in the UK must display it clearly. RTP is the theoretical percentage of all wagered money that a game returns to players over a very long period — think hundreds of thousands of spins, not your Tuesday afternoon session. A game with 96% RTP does not owe you £96 for every £100 you stake; it simply means that, across the entire player base over time, the maths settles near that figure.

Fruit machines in the classic style tend to sit in the 94% to 97% range. The older, simpler titles often land lower because their jackpots are fixed and small; the newer hybrid games push higher to compete with video slots. Volatility, meanwhile, tells you about the shape of the payouts. Low volatility means frequent small wins and a gentle bankroll decline. High volatility means long dry spells punctuated by occasional larger hits. A nudge-and-hold game is usually medium volatility by design — the feature exists to convert near-misses into wins, which smooths the curve.

All licensed games in Great Britain undergo certified RNG testing. Independent laboratories such as eCOGRA and iTech Labs verify that the random number generator is genuinely random and that the published RTP matches reality within a tolerance band. When you play at a UKGC-licensed operator, you are not taking the developer’s word for it — the testing is a condition of the licence. Stake Limits and Structuring a Sensible Session

Since 2025, Great Britain has had statutory stake limits for online slots: £5 per spin for players aged 25 and over, and £2 per spin for those aged 18 to 24. These are hard legal ceilings set by the regulator, not marketing suggestions, and every licensed operator enforces them automatically. If you are under 25, the system will know and will cap your stake regardless of what you select in the game menu.

For classic fruit machines, these limits rarely bite. Most nudge-and-hold titles are designed for stakes between 10p and £1 per spin, and playing at the maximum is rarely the smart move. A sensible session structure looks like this: decide your total budget before you log in, split it into ten equal portions, and stop when a portion is gone. If a nudge feature appears, use it deliberately — look at the reels, count the positions, and ask whether the potential win justifies the spin you are about to take. Gambling with credit cards has been banned in Great Britain since April 2020, so any deposit you make must come from a debit card, e-wallet, or bank transfer. This is a deliberate protection: it stops you from gambling with borrowed money. Pair that with a voluntary deposit limit on your account, and you have a structure that keeps the entertainment in entertainment.

Why does RTP matter if I am only playing for an hour?

RTP is a long-run statistical average, so a single hour of play can end well above or below it through pure luck. What RTP does give you is a fair comparison between games: over many sessions, a 97% game will typically cost you less than a 94% game. Use it as a tie-breaker between two titles you enjoy, not as a promise for your next spin.
